Children among 12 Palestinians killed in fresh Israeli strikes in Gaza

- At least 404 Palestinians killed in renewed Israeli airstrikes in Gaza despite ceasefire deal

By Nour Abuaisha and Rania Abu Shamala

GAZA CITY, Palestine /ISTANBUL (AA) – More than 12 people, including children, were killed and several others injured in fresh Israeli airstrikes in the Gaza Strip on Tuesday, medics said.

A medical source said children were among six Palestinians who lost their lives when an Israeli fighter jet hit a vehicle in the Al-Salateen neighborhood in northern Gaza.

Six more people were killed in another strike on a house in the Nuseirat refugee camp in central Gaza, the source added.

Local sources said that five people were injured in an Israeli airstrike on a car west of Gaza City.

Injuries were also reported in an airstrike targeting a group of civilians outside a hospital in western Gaza City, according to civil defense spokesman Mahmoud Basal.

The Israeli army pounded the Gaza Strip early Tuesday, killing at least 404 people, injuring hundreds, and breaking a ceasefire agreement that took effect on Jan. 19.

Images emerging from Gaza showed that the majority of the victims were civilians, including women and children, whose homes were bombed during the night.

More than 48,500 Palestinians have been killed, mostly women and children, and over 112,000 others injured in a brutal Israeli military campaign in Gaza since October 2023.

In November 2024, the International Criminal Court issued arrest warrants for Netanyahu and his former Defense Minister Yoav Gallant for war crimes and crimes against humanity in Gaza.

Israel also faces a genocide case at the International Court of Justice for its war on the enclave.
